Resqunit AB (publ) operates as an ocean technology firm, conducting its activities in Sweden through its subsidiary, Resqunit AS. The company specializes in creating innovative equipment to mitigate the problem of lost fishing gear. Its product line includes the Backup Buoy, which helps fishers locate and recover their discarded equipment, and the electronically controlled Escape Hatch, designed to halt "ghost-fishing" by releasing marine life from abandoned traps and pots. Additionally, Resqunit develops ocean data sensors. Established in 2017, Resqunit AB (publ) is headquartered in Sandnes, Norway.

How to read a P/E ratio?

The Price/Earnings ratio measures the relationship between a company's stock price and its earnings per share.
A low but positive P/E ratio stands for a company that is generating high earnings compared to its current valuation and might be undervalued. A company with a high negative (near 0) P/E ratio stands for a company that is generating heavy losses compared to its current valuation.

Companies with a P/E ratio over 30 or a negative one are generaly seen as "growth stocks" meaning that investors typically expect the company to grow or to become profitable in the future.

Companies with a positive P/E ratio bellow 10 are generally seen as "value stocks" meaning that the company is already very profitable and unlikely to strong growth in the future.
